Trans List Crawler: Web Scraping Your Way To Data
Hey everyone! Ever wondered how websites gather all that juicy data you see? Or maybe you're a data enthusiast looking to get your hands dirty with some web scraping? Well, you've stumbled upon the right place! Today, we're diving headfirst into the world of trans list crawlers, also known as web scrapers, and figuring out how they work their magic. Buckle up, because we're about to get technical, but don't worry, I'll keep it real and easy to understand. We're talking about the nuts and bolts of automatically grabbing data from the web β it's like having a super-powered browser that does the work for you! So, let's get started, shall we?
What Exactly is a Trans List Crawler?
So, what exactly is a trans list crawler, you ask? In a nutshell, it's a program or a script that automatically browses the World Wide Web and extracts information from websites. Think of it as a digital detective that systematically searches, reads, and then collects the information you tell it to find. This data can be anything from product prices, contact details, or even the entire text of a webpage. These crawlers are incredibly versatile tools, and they can be used for a ton of different things, like market research, price comparison, or even monitoring changes on a competitor's website. Now, the term 'trans list' in this context refers to the process of 'traversing' or 'crawling' through a list, or multiple lists, of URLs. It's all about the systematic process of visiting pages, identifying the data you want, and storing it. These crawlers are designed to mimic human browsing, but with superhuman speed and efficiency. No more manually copying and pasting data all day long! A trans list crawler can handle hundreds, even thousands, of pages in a fraction of the time it would take a human. That's the power of automation, my friends!
We often refer to these as web scrapers or web harvesters. They are used by businesses, researchers, and even individuals looking to gather data from various online sources. They can be incredibly useful for tasks like tracking stock prices, monitoring news articles, or collecting contact information. Whether you are creating a price comparison website, gathering data for a research project, or just simply curious, a web scraper can be a great tool. Just imagine the possibilities! Instead of spending hours manually collecting data, you can automate the process and have all the information you need at your fingertips. With a web scraper, you're basically building your own personalized search engine, tailored to extract the exact data you need. How cool is that?
How Do Trans List Crawlers Work Their Magic?
Now, let's get into the nitty-gritty of how these trans list crawlers actually work. The process is pretty fascinating! The basic steps involve sending an HTTP request to a website, receiving the HTML content, parsing the HTML, and extracting the desired data. It's like a secret handshake between the crawler and the web server. First, the crawler starts by sending a request to a specific URL. This is like asking the website, "Hey, can I see your content?" The website then sends back the HTML code, which is the structure of the webpage, like the bones of a body. Then, the crawler parses this HTML code. Parsing means analyzing the HTML to understand its structure β the tags, the attributes, and the content within them. Think of it like reading a book: the crawler needs to understand how the sentences and paragraphs are organized. The crawler then uses selectors (like CSS selectors or XPath) to target the specific elements you want to extract. These selectors act like precision tools, allowing the crawler to pinpoint the exact data points you're interested in, like the title of a product, its price, or a description. Finally, the crawler extracts the data and saves it. This is where the magic happens! The crawler saves the extracted data in a structured format, such as a CSV file, a database, or a JSON file, ready for you to use. This is the raw data that you can then analyze, use to create reports, or feed into other applications. β Schedule An AT&T Store Appointment: Easy Guide
These crawlers are typically built using programming languages like Python (with libraries like Scrapy and Beautiful Soup), which makes the process much easier. They can handle complex tasks like navigating through multiple pages, dealing with dynamic content, and even avoiding being blocked by websites. A trans list crawler is essentially an automated web browser that is specifically designed to extract information efficiently and effectively. Itβs the perfect tool for anyone who needs to collect and analyze data from multiple websites. If you're looking for a way to automate data extraction, a web scraper might just be your new best friend!
Ethical Considerations and Legal Boundaries
Before you get too excited and start scraping everything in sight, it's important to talk about ethics and legality. Web scraping can be a bit of a gray area, so it's crucial to understand the rules of the game. The first and most important thing is to respect the website's terms of service and robots.txt file. The terms of service outline what the website allows you to do, and the robots.txt file tells crawlers which parts of the site they are allowed to access. Ignoring these can lead to being blocked or even legal trouble. Always check the website's robots.txt file before scraping. It's usually located at /robots.txt
at the end of the domain. This file gives instructions to web robots about which areas of the site they are allowed to crawl and which they should avoid. You should also be mindful of the server's resources. Don't bombard a website with requests, as this can slow it down or even crash it. Implement delays between requests to be polite. Think of it like this: you wouldn't barge into someone's house and start rummaging through their things without asking, right? Similarly, you shouldn't scrape a website without considering their rules and the impact your actions might have. β Political Cartoons: Satire & Town Hall
Respecting these guidelines is not only the ethical thing to do, but it's also practical. Websites are constantly evolving their security measures to prevent scraping, so by playing nice, you're less likely to run into problems. If you're scraping a website, be sure to identify yourself clearly. This allows website administrators to reach out to you if they have any questions or concerns. It also helps them understand what you're doing and why. Web scraping can also raise privacy concerns. Be mindful of any personal data you're collecting and make sure you're complying with data protection regulations, such as GDPR and CCPA. Remember that privacy is paramount, and you need to handle any data responsibly. Keep in mind that web scraping is a powerful tool, and with great power comes great responsibility. The responsible use of web scraping involves respecting the rules and regulations of the websites you are scraping, protecting the privacy of individuals, and not causing undue harm to web resources. So, do your research, be respectful, and happy scraping!
Tools and Technologies for Building Trans List Crawlers
Okay, so you're ready to build your own trans list crawler? Awesome! Let's talk about some of the tools and technologies that can help you get started. The good news is, you don't need to be a coding wizard to get started. There are plenty of resources and tools available to help you. The most popular programming language for web scraping is Python. Python is a versatile and user-friendly language that's perfect for beginners and experts alike. Python also has a massive ecosystem of libraries specifically designed for web scraping.
Some of the most popular Python libraries for web scraping include Beautiful Soup and Scrapy. Beautiful Soup is a library for parsing HTML and XML documents, which means it helps you make sense of the structure of a webpage. It's great for extracting data from static websites. Scrapy is a more advanced web scraping framework that is designed for large-scale web scraping projects. It provides a full suite of features, including spider management, data extraction, and data storage. It's great for projects that require crawling multiple pages and handling more complex tasks. You can also use libraries like Requests, which is a library for making HTTP requests. This is how the crawler actually fetches the HTML content from a website. Other useful libraries include Selenium, which is a browser automation tool that can be used to scrape dynamic websites, and XPath, which is a query language for selecting nodes from an XML document. In addition to these Python libraries, there are also many other tools available. You can use web scraping browser extensions or online web scraping services, which can make the process even easier. Web scraping is a great way to extract information from the web.
The Future of Trans List Crawlers
So, what does the future hold for trans list crawlers? The web is constantly evolving, and so are the tools we use to navigate it. As websites become more complex and dynamic, web scrapers will need to adapt. We can expect to see more sophisticated techniques for bypassing anti-scraping measures and extracting data from dynamic content. Artificial intelligence (AI) and machine learning (ML) will play a bigger role in web scraping. AI can be used to automatically identify and extract data, even from websites with complex structures. ML can also be used to train web scrapers to adapt to changes in website structure and layout. This means that web scrapers will be able to identify data even more accurately and efficiently. In addition to these advancements, the rise of the 'headless' browser will continue to evolve web scraping. Headless browsers allow crawlers to render websites in a simulated browser environment, allowing them to handle complex JavaScript and dynamic content.
Furthermore, we can expect to see even more focus on ethical web scraping practices. With greater awareness of data privacy and the impact of scraping on websites, the developers of web scrapers will need to be more responsible. As the tools and techniques for web scraping continue to evolve, so will the importance of understanding the legal and ethical considerations. This means staying informed about the latest regulations and best practices and respecting the rules of the websites you are scraping. The future of trans list crawlers is full of exciting possibilities! The landscape is constantly changing and will be a crucial part of the digital world. By staying informed and adapting to new trends, you can stay ahead of the curve and use these tools effectively. β Filmy4wap XYZ: Watch South Movies Online
Conclusion
Alright, guys, that's a wrap for today's deep dive into trans list crawlers! We've covered everything from the basics of how they work to the ethical considerations you need to keep in mind. Now you're equipped with the knowledge to start your own web scraping adventure. Remember to be respectful of website owners, follow the rules, and always prioritize ethical practices. The world of web scraping is full of possibilities, so get out there, experiment, and have fun!
Happy scraping! And feel free to ask me any questions in the comments below. Cheers!